Pok-5-wyk-Slajd3
Z Studia Informatyczne
Metoda zstępująca
Rozpoczniemy od metody zstępującej, która jest de facto poszukiwaniem lewostronnego wyprowadzenia dla zdania będącego ciągiem wejściowym.
Metodę tę można również omawiać jako budowę drzewa wyprowadzenia dla wejścia. Rozpoczynając od korzenia, wierzchołki tworzy się zgodnie z porządkiem preorder. To co odróżnia tę metodę od metody wstępującej, która omawiana będzie na następnym wykładzie to fakt, iż przetwarzanie rozpoczynamy od symbolu startowego a następnie stosujemy wyprowadzenie tak długo aż osiągniemy zdanie wejściowe, lub odpowiedź, iż nie da się wygenerować takiego zdania.